X



トップページ運用情報
1001コメント282KB

【堅牢】トリップの新方式を考えてみませんか【互換性】

レス数が950を超えています。1000を超えると書き込みができなくなります。
0001NAO ★
垢版 |
2009/06/15(月) 00:38:24ID:???0
現段階でのトリップの問題点などを考えつつ、
現行方式よりも堅牢なトリップの方式を考えてみませんか。

マルチバイト文字問題や互換性などの問題も出てくると思いますが、
そこは皆で妙案を出し合いつつ、新たな方式を頑張って考えてみましょう。


関係スレ
 幸せサーバープロジェクト 「アイデア・技術のある人募集中」★3
 http://qb5.2ch.net/test/read.cgi/operate/1241361889/
0893動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 20:49:15ID:jklXwVL20
beの新トリップ対応はなんかよからぬことが起こりそうなので
そっとしておいてあげたい今日この頃です
0902 ◆SsSSsSsSSs
垢版 |
2009/06/22(月) 21:08:52ID:tX2vNhUl0
堅牢性全然あがってないよね
0907 ◆SsSSsSsSSs
垢版 |
2009/06/22(月) 21:10:44ID:tX2vNhUl0
CUDAのもあるしね

>>901
メールしました
0908動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 21:15:19ID:lUvjxh66P
こんだけ処理早くなったら、せっかく作った新方式の
寿命も、縮まるばかりではないだろうか
なんという本末転倒www

>>835
# 10053472 Trips in 37 sec - 271 kTrips/sec
Celeron 540 @1.86GHz
0909動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 21:18:30ID:1R2YwtP80
Gなら8,9完ぐらいは狙えるのかな?
その分、キー空間(?)は膨大になってる(?)んだろうから・・・10〜 以上はやっぱ神トリか?

Mでるトリッパーが出てみないと力技への強度(感覚)はよくわからないけど。
0911動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 21:27:11ID:1R2YwtP80
まあ、総当たりの力技で12完合わせられなきゃ(割られなきゃ)問題はないわけで。
割れやすいキーを使うのは、また別問題だからなあ。
0912動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 21:31:17ID:4FizNz640?2BP(3434)
キーが1024bytesまで使えるようになったとはいえ
64^12 通りの出力を得れば全て割れたことになりますからね。

もう少し無駄を入れるなりして演算に時間のかかるアルゴリズムにしたほうがいいのかも。
0913動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 21:32:01ID:unoM1EqQ0
うん。10完と12完じゃ桁違い…なハズ。でも長くてユニークな可読キーってたぶん意外と少ないから
known key数が速やかに増えちゃうのは困るか
0914動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 21:36:02ID:1R2YwtP80
今のは遊び用?にして
拡張用の#$ でも使ってブラックボックスのトリでも作ればいいんじゃない?
そこまで必要か疑問だけど。

まあ、1年程度動かしてからでいいような・・・
0915,,・´∀`・,,)っ-○○○
垢版 |
2009/06/22(月) 21:37:32ID:4uPmJjvs0
ブラックボックスにするくらいならBlowfishでええやん。
有効な並列化手法がないし。
0917 ◆SsSSsSsSSs
垢版 |
2009/06/22(月) 21:42:48ID:tX2vNhUl0
>>915
メール見ました?
結局アイコン作らなかった人ですよ

だんごやさんのオススメ不可逆暗号はなんですか?
0918動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 21:44:26ID:1R2YwtP80
だいたい、同じトリ付けて数年も2ちゃんに入り浸るようなのはそんなに多くないような・・・
なんか石投げられそうだけどw
0919あひるちゃん ◆z0WvbsWRgg
垢版 |
2009/06/22(月) 21:45:53ID:h8znd6T/0
何のアイコン?マックに対応するなら何か作ろうか
0921動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 21:48:39ID:Nas+Wii/0
そもそも12完鳥なんて数年も使うのか?
ゲーム関係なら1年位で変更だと思うけど。
文化系の人とかか?
0923動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 21:53:47ID:hfD+SSxP0
>>912
ただその64^12の文字列集合に対して全射となるような元が
最低何文字の文字列なのか、という問題がある

逆に、メッセージダイジェストの一部分しか使用しない事、
Base64というエンコーディングによって、
キーとトリップ文字列の対応関係にどのような重複領域が生じるか
その辺りがまだ良く分かってないから
しばらくの間は試行錯誤が必要だろう
0928 ◆Horo/.IBXjcg
垢版 |
2009/06/22(月) 22:06:16ID:eGV7idXT0
ttp://www1.axfc.net/uploader/Sc/so/11308

少し直したら速くなりおった。

ここしばらくまともにプログラム書いておらなんだからの。

大文字小文字を区別しないようにするには-iオプション付けてくりゃれ。

マルチスレッド対応とかREADME書くのとか面倒じゃ w
0931 ◆Horo/.IBXjcg
垢版 |
2009/06/22(月) 22:38:09ID:eGV7idXT0
>>895

流石じゃの。

わっちの頭ではBitslice DESもよう理解せなんだ。

>>907

CUDAでSHA-1とか凄そうじゃの。

>>912

sha1_base64()なら27文字まで増やせるようじゃが。

>>913

辞書攻撃は気になるの。
0933動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 22:52:37ID:1R2YwtP80
exampleを右クリック→編集

trip_search_sha1-2.exe "^Horo/" >> trip.txt
                  ↑
                探したいトリに変える

で上書き保存→実行でいいんじゃないかな。
0936動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 22:56:24ID:1R2YwtP80
一回、書いとけばレス番指定で済むしねー
それに、みんながみんな詳しいわけでもないしレス読んで分ったことも
実は、キーワードが分らずにこのスレで知ったw
わっちでぐぐって狼となんとか関連だと思ってたのはナイショだw
0940株価【667】 ◆???
垢版 |
2009/06/22(月) 23:07:13ID:ZLvdWjTm0
>>933

trip_search_sha1-2.exe "^Horo/" >> trip.txt

これを↑ こうしていいんだよね?↓

trip_search_sha1-2.exe "xxxxxx" >> trip.txt
0941動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 23:07:27ID:NMUg5FrVO
trip_search_sha1-2.exe "keyword" >> trip.txt


keywordのリファレンス

^hoge:hogeから始まる
hoge$:hogeで終わる
[AGH]:AかGかH
[A-Z]:A〜Zのうち一文字
[a-z]:a〜zのうち一文字
[0-9]:0〜9のうち一文字
キーワードに.を使う時は\.


基本的にこんなもん?
間違いあったら修正お願い。
0942株価【667】 ◆???
垢版 |
2009/06/22(月) 23:10:47ID:ZLvdWjTm0

これじゃ ! を指定しても永遠に終わらないって事だよね?
0946hehehe ◆2SfH7.66666G
垢版 |
2009/06/22(月) 23:20:23ID:2s4CeA600
perlってことはどこでも動くね。
こりゃすごいとか言ってみるテスツ
0947 ◆TwArAmHjJZ5J
垢版 |
2009/06/22(月) 23:28:57ID:S67Kpt4u0?BRZ(10072)
>>928
##### ignore case #####
if ($ignore_case){
えーっ、、、

おそらく速度的には変わらないと思うけれどもこの辺りに。。。
つ print "$tript#$key2n" if m!(?($ignore_case)(?i)$pattern|$pattern)!o;

変更するときに複数箇所同じ変更をしなきゃいけない描き方は、あとでえらい目に遭います♪
0948 ◆TwArAmHjJZ5J
垢版 |
2009/06/22(月) 23:42:16ID:S67Kpt4u0?BRZ(10072)
>>947
つ print "$tript#$key2n" if m!(?($ignore_case)(?i)$pattern|$pattern)!o; ×
使い方が違います(´・ω・`)
0949 ◆TwArAmHjJZ5J
垢版 |
2009/06/22(月) 23:47:45ID:S67Kpt4u0?BRZ(10072)
$pattern = qq|(?i)$pattern| if $ignore_case;
して・・・
print "$tript#$key2n" if m!$pattern!o;
かなかな。。。
0950 ◆TwArAmHjJZ5J
垢版 |
2009/06/22(月) 23:52:57ID:S67Kpt4u0?BRZ(10072)
>>949
すでに頭が固まっている、、、
× print "$tript#$key2n" if m!$pattern!o;
○ print "$tript#$key2n" if $trip =~ m!$pattern!o;

"$c1$c2$c3$c4"は、固定値なので本ループの前にあらかじめ作っておくと良いかも♪
0951動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/22(月) 23:57:58ID:kFeMRZcA0
>>888
中の人じゃないけどi386/x86_64/ppc/ppc64のユニバーサルなのを作り中。
いずれもシングルスレッドで

Core 2 Duo 2.3GHz (Leopard):
i386+sse2: 7.5M trip/sec
x86_64+sse2: 10.5M trip/sec

G5 2.0GHz (Tiger):
ppc+altivec: 4.6M trip/sec
ppc64+altivec: 4.75M trip/sec

G4 667MHz (Panther):
ppc+altivec: 1.48M trip/sec

これに前方一致とかキーのイテレーションとかログ記録を追加するから
完成品でどれぐらい性能が維持できているかは不明。
0953 ◆TWARamEjuA
垢版 |
2009/06/23(火) 00:06:54ID:viaSJ7ww0?BRZ(10072)
>>950
やっぱり頭が固まっている、、、
"$c1$c2$c3$c4"は、固定値なので本ループの前にあらかじめ作っておくと良いかも♪

my @chars = (aaaa .. zzzz);
1行でおわりだた。。。
0957 ◆???
垢版 |
2009/06/23(火) 00:12:34ID:Fj3XnSKL0
se
0958 ◆s1wm0AZG56
垢版 |
2009/06/23(火) 00:12:51ID:Fj3XnSKL0
tes
0960 ◆TWARamEjuA
垢版 |
2009/06/23(火) 00:20:36ID:viaSJ7ww0?BRZ(10072)
>>953
# 10053472 Trips in 57 sec - 176 kTrips/sec

# 10053472 Trips in 45 sec - 223 kTrips/sec
ちょっぴり速くなりました♪
0961 ◆cz.Trip..PlX
垢版 |
2009/06/23(火) 00:29:06ID:ZvGYohk30
マルチで失礼
SSEとかは使いこなせないのであんまり速くないですが
ttp://www1.axfc.net/uploader/Sc/so/11313

ついでに言うとマルチコア非対応ですけど…
0962 ◆TWARamEjuA
垢版 |
2009/06/23(火) 00:36:21ID:viaSJ7ww0?BRZ(10072)
ほぉほぉ。。。
# 10053472 Trips in 16 sec - 628 kTrips/sec
Core 2 Duo E7200 @ 2.53GHz/Vine4.2
0963 ◆Horo/.IBXjcg
垢版 |
2009/06/23(火) 00:39:03ID:kUkRywrl0
>>949-950

そんな便利なパターンマッチの書き方があったのかや。

>>951

やはりSIMDは凄いの。

>>953

巨大な配列を避けてしまうのはわっちの頭が古いのかもしれんの。

本当はとりあえず動く物を作ったのが一番の理由だがの w
0966 ◆SsSSsSsSSs
垢版 |
2009/06/23(火) 00:48:51ID:Fj3XnSKL0?PLT(12021)
>>961
txで15 MのPCで3Mだからまあまあ優秀なんじゃね?

0968 ◆???
垢版 |
2009/06/23(火) 00:49:42ID:oeVqitf+0
>>961
先頭指定で1個 2600k/s
E5200 2.5GHz
0969 ◆Q9V9S9o9r9f9
垢版 |
2009/06/23(火) 00:56:58ID:Wbjl7lD60
>>961
もらいました。ありがとうございます><

^AAAAAAAA〜^ZZZZZZZZ^aaaaaaaa〜^zzzzzzzz^........^////////
で1038k

^TRIP
で2587k
0981動け動けウゴウゴ2ちゃんねる
垢版 |
2009/06/23(火) 02:27:46ID:6B7Y8fKo0
そこはピリオドで終わって欲しかった.
0986 ◆NAO/2MXDEk
垢版 |
2009/06/23(火) 02:50:30ID:LiDVRl/70
とりあえず最小化して、放置してみた
0987 ◆Horo/.IBXjcg
垢版 |
2009/06/23(火) 04:26:24ID:kUkRywrl0
ttp://www1.axfc.net/uploader/Sc/so/11425

久々にPerlについて調べていたらこんな時間になっておった。

大文字小文字を無視する場合は、パターンの先頭に(?i)を付けてくりゃれ。

速度では勝負になりそうに無いからの、マニア向けの方が面白そうじゃろ。
0988,,・´∀`・,,)っ-○○○
垢版 |
2009/06/23(火) 04:52:28ID:/jiXePBQ0
ほんとのところ、Tripcode Explorer 2(仮)はGUI設計に専念しようと思ってたんだよね
ユーザーインターフェイス設計とアルゴリズムチューニングって同時には頭まわんねー。
誰かコラボする?
レス数が950を超えています。1000を超えると書き込みができなくなります。

ニューススポーツなんでも実況